| contents | A reproducible certificate-level closure for the active theta bridge G(x) = theta(x) - x against the RH-scale envelope 1.9233607946440099 * sqrt(x) * log(x)^2. The package provides a one-command audit runner that reproduces PASS for all post-P0 first-exit obstruction checks, including coordinate-gap normalized margin safety (141/141), ThresholdRelevance (10140 rows / 0 failures), candidate window coverage (142/142), and local obstruction closure. This constitutes a certificate-level route toward the Chebyshev/von Koch RH-scale criterion, pending independent mathematical verification. |
